Understanding Treadmills: Types, Benefits, and Considerations
Treadmills have become an important part of fitness culture, offering a practical solution for individuals looking for to improve their cardiovascular physical fitness without the requirement for outdoor spaces or weather factors to consider. With a selection of features and models offered, possible buyers should be well-informed to make the very best decision. This post intends to supply a comprehensive overview of treadmills, consisting of the different types, benefits, and factors to think about when acquiring one.
The Different Types of Treadmills1. Handbook Treadmills
Manual treadmills are powered by the user instead of an electric motor. They need no electrical power and typically include a basic style with less moving parts.
Benefits of Manual Treadmills:Cost-effectivePortable and light-weightNo reliance on electricityDownsides:Limited featuresNormally do not have slope options2. Motorized Treadmills
Motorized treadmills are the most common type, powered by an electric motor. They generally provide different features such as programmable exercise routines, adjustable inclines, and greater weight capacities.
Benefits of Motorized Treadmills:Smooth operation and constant tractionVersatile with advanced features for varied exercisesOptions for incline and decline settingsDisadvantages:Higher expense compared to manual treadmillsNeed electrical power and might increase electric bills3. Folding Treadmills
Folding treadmills are developed for simple storage, making them perfect for those with minimal area.
Benefits of Folding Treadmills:Space-saving styleEasy to transfer and keepAppropriate for home usage where space is at a premiumDownsides:Typically might have a smaller sized running surfaceWeight limitation might be lower than non-folding models4. Industrial Treadmills
These treadmills are developed for resilience and efficiency, usually found in gyms and fitness centers. They are created for high use rates and come with innovative features.

Treadmills offer numerous benefits for individuals looking to enhance their physical fitness levels or maintain an athletic routine.
1. Convenience
Owning a treadmill permits users to exercise at their own schedule, getting rid of reliance on weather. It supplies flexibility, as exercises can happen day or night.
2. Customizable Workouts
Many modern treadmills feature customizable programs to accommodate novices and experienced professional athletes. Users can change speed, slope, and workout period to take full advantage of the efficiency of their sessions.
3. Tracking Progress
Most treadmills come equipped with digital displays that tape-record essential data such as distance, speed, calories burned, and heart rate. Monitoring this information assists users track their physical fitness development with time.
4. Reduced Impact
Treadmills often offer a cushioned surface area that can lower joint effect compared to operating on hard outdoor surface areas, making them a suitable option for individuals with joint issues or those recovering from injuries.
5. Variety of Workouts
Users can participate in various exercises on a treadmill, from walking and running to interval training and speed work. Some machines even use built-in courses that mimic outdoor surfaces.

What is the typical life expectancy of a treadmill?
Typically, a high-quality treadmill can last in between 7 to 12 years, depending on usage, upkeep, and develop quality.
2. What is the best treadmill brand name?
Popular brands consist of NordicTrack, Sole Fitness, Precor, and LifeSpan, each understood for their quality and client satisfaction.
3. Can I use a treadmill for walking?
Yes, treadmills are best for walking, running, or running, making them versatile for users of all fitness levels.
4. How often should I service my treadmill?
Regular maintenance is generally suggested every six months to ensure ideal performance and longevity.
5. Is it all right to run on a treadmill every day?
While operating on a treadmill daily is appropriate for some, it's smart to integrate rest days or alternate exercises to prevent possible overuse injuries.
